Non-perturbative renormalization of the axial current with improved Wilson quarks

  • 1. Humboldt-Universitaet, Berlin (Germany). Inst. fuer Physik
  • 2. Deutsches Elektronen-Synchrotron (DESY), Zeuthen (Germany)

Description

We present a new normalization condition for the axial current, which is derived from the PCAC relation with non-vanishing mass. Using this condition reduces the O(r0m) corrections to the axial current normalization constant ZA for an easier chiral extrapolation in the cases, where simulations at zero quark-mass are not possible. The method described here also serves as a preparation for a determination of ZA in the full two-flavor theory. (orig.)
